Abstract:
Described herein are non-invasive or minimally invasive methods and compositions for collecting and assessing samples for detection of gastrointestinal (GI) tract cancers and pancreatic cancers. Samples comprising gastrointestinal lavage fluid (GLF) are obtained from subjects and screened against a glycan microarray to reveal disease-specific glycan-binding patterns by immunoglobulins contained in the GLF, especially immunoglobulin A (IgA). The disease-specific glycan-binding patterns include a disease-specific glycan or subset of glycans from the microarray that are bound by the immunoglobulins in GLF at highest intensities or at lowest intensities, as well as one or more glycan motifs found within this disease-specific subset of glycans.
